Editorial note
The KTM 85 SX (2011) stands out for its optimal performance, offering both power and maneuverability, making it a perfect choice for young riders seeking thrills. The quality of KTM's manufacturing ensures robustness and durability, allowing this bike to withstand the most demanding riding conditions. Additionally, the ergonomic design is specifically tailored for youth, promoting a comfortable and secure grip. However, it is worth noting that the bike's power can make it difficult for beginners to handle, resulting in a longer learning curve. Furthermore, maintenance and spare parts costs can be high, which could pose a problem for users on a limited budget. Although the model is suitable for young riders, it can quickly become too small or underperforming as they progress. In terms of features, the KTM 85 SX (2011) lacks some modern innovations, such as electronic fuel injection, which may make it less competitive against newer models. Nevertheless, the provided user manual makes it easier to use, even for those who are new to motorcycles. In summary, the KTM 85 SX (2011) is a high-performing and well-designed bike for young riders, but beginners may face challenges due to its power and weight. Maintenance costs and the lack of certain modern features are also factors to consider before purchasing.Score details
